No. mg means milligram - 1/1000 of a gram. ug means microgram - 1/1,000,000 of a gram. Actually the Greek letter "mu" (µ) should be used, but since it is sometimes difficult to type it, the letter "u" may be substituted.

1 mg = 1,000 ug 1 mg per Liter = 1,000 ug per Liter. 1 mg per Liter is 1,000 times as concentrated as 1 ug per Liter.
